Requirements / Qualifications

DEFINITION Under the direction of the Maintenance Supervisor, performs skilled work in the repair of worn or damaged fabricated, machined, cast, forged, or welded parts; performs skilled work using electric arc, and oxygen-acetylene welding equipment; assists other maintenance personnel by performing semiskilled or skilled duties in other maintenance trade areas; performs other related work as required and/or assigned. EXPERIENCE AND EDUCATION Experience: Two years of experience as a journeyman level welder. Education: Verification of a High School diploma, a GED certificate, or a higher degree, supplemental course work or training in welding, metal fabrication, and other related trade areas is desirable. License Requirement: Possession of a valid California Motor Vehicle Operator’s License. Condition of Employment: Insurability by the District’s liability insurance carrier may be required. Finalists scheduled for an interview must provide a current DMV printout (not more than 30 days old) prior to the interview.
